linux 设置默认目录

2018-08-14 15:20:27 Romance5201314 阅读数 14156

1.查看当前默认的Python版本

打开终端,输入python
这里写图片描述
可以看到当前系统中默认的python版本是 2.7.12

2. 修改默认Python版本

下面把默认的python版本从2.7改为3.5
进入”/usr/bin”目录下,输入”ls -l | grep python”显示所有名字中包含python的文件
这里写图片描述
可以看到是python指向的是python2,而Python2指向的是Python2.7

lrwxrwxrwx 1 root root          16 814 14:26 python -> /usr/bin/python2
lrwxrwxrwx 1 root root           9 103  2017 python2 -> python2.7

只要把python的指向改为python3即可,Python3指向的是Python3.5

$ sudo rm -rf python
$ sudo ln -s /usr/bin/python3  /usr/bin/python

再执行Python命令,可以看到
默认版本已经改成Python3.5.2了
这里写图片描述

2018-04-07 10:44:28 onebigday 阅读数 12649

切换到root用户,使用usermod命令,例如usermod -d /tmp test (test为你的用户名),使用该命令请确保该用户下没有运行的软件或进程

最后使用 cat /etc/passwd  查看用户路径

2017-11-08 02:38:54 qq_31833457 阅读数 6095

1、linux用户登录后默认目录是在/etc/passwd文件设置的。如下图所示,一共显示了四行数据,其中第一行的/root即为root用户登录后的默认目录,第二行daemon用户的默认目录是/usr/sbin。

2、要修改登录后默认目录,可以用vim编辑器,打开/etc/passwd ,找到相应的用户,修改倒数第一个冒号前面的目录即可,如下图所示。

2015-11-28 22:11:28 xp178171640 阅读数 2424

一般情况下,登录到linux系统中,当前目录是home目录,

即/home/XXX(root为/root)。


如果经常是登录后就立即切换到/test,

我们可以修改文件~\.bashrc,在其中添加一行:

cd /test


那么在下次登录时就直接位于/test下而无需目录切换。

~\.bashrc如果不存在新建即可。

~\.bashrc会在用户登录时读取。



2015-07-06 16:09:20 aa120515692 阅读数 5935

ping 114.114.114.114 都是ping不通,提示如下:

root@DayDream:/# ping www.baidu.com
ping: bad address 'www.baidu.com'

root@DayDream:/# ping 114.114.114.114
PING 114.114.114.114 (114.114.114.114): 56 data bytes
ping: sendto: Network is unreachable

输入 route 。发现没有设置网关:

root@DayDream:/# route 
Kernel IP routing table
Destination     Gateway         Genmask         Flags Metric Ref    Use Iface
113.115.0.1     *               255.255.255.255 UH    0      0        0 3g-ppp0
192.168.20.0    *               255.255.255.0   U     0      0        0 br-lan

于是,设置上默认网关

route add default gw 113.115.0.1

在尝试一次。发现成功了:

root@DayDream:/# ping www.baidu.com
PING www.baidu.com (180.97.33.107): 56 data bytes
64 bytes from 180.97.33.107: seq=0 ttl=55 time=87.532 ms